Inter School District Level Competition gets underway
5/28/2018 10:53:28 PM
Early Times Report

Jammu, May 28: Inter School District Level Competitions in the sports discipline of Judo, Yoga, Jeet Kwando, Kurash, Gymnastic, Karate, Rope Skipping U/14 and 17yrs (Boys) & Tennis Ball Cricket & Tennis Cricket U/17 yrs (Boys) got underway today here at Indoor Complex M.A Stadium & Green Field Gandhi Nagar, Jammu respectively.
In all near about 300 boys are drawn across from 14 Zones of Jammu District are taking part in the competitions. The competitions are organised by Department of Youth Services & Sports under the patronage of Shiekh Fayaz Ahmad , KAS, Director General, Youth Services & Sports and under the overall supervision of Madan Lal, Joint Director Youth Services & Sports Jammu while Chanchal Kour, DYSSO Jammu was the organising Secretary of the tournament. Chanchal Kour DYSSO Jammu declared the competitions open in presence of the players and the Zonal Physical Education Officers of District Jammu. While addressing the gathering she said that students should take part in sports for the development of self confidence and also for the development of mind & body. She further said to participants "Play the game, play it well" with sportsman spirit. Later on, she wished them all the best during the competitions. The main objective of the competitions is to select the teams of District Jammu for next level of competition.
